Indian equities witnessed strong momentum as the Sensex surged 3.54% over five sessions ending February 6. Amid the rally, 33 BSE 500 stocks gained consistently, with 13 delivering uninterrupted five-day advances. These stocks posted cumulative returns ranging from 10% to 21%, highlighting broad-based market strength.

In a surprising turn of events, Indian stock markets rebounded on Friday after starting the day in the red. Traders reacted to optimistic developments surrounding a US-India trade agreement, even as apprehensions loomed over the global tech industry. Both the Nifty and Sensex climbed slightly, though the IT sector faced downturns.

India’s IPO market gears up for a busy week as three issues worth Rs 3,871 crore open between February 9 and 16. Fractal Analytics and Aye Finance lead the mainboard segment, while Marushika Technology adds momentum on the SME platform.

The Dow Jones Industrial Average surpassed 50,000 for the first time on Friday, closing up 2.47%. This historic milestone was boosted by Caterpillar’s significant gains and a broader market rally beyond technology. Investors are diversifying, benefiting economically sensitive companies and contributing to the Dow’s outperformance this year.

Investors face a volatile week as artificial intelligence reshapes the technology sector. Software stocks are experiencing a significant downturn. Upcoming economic data on employment and inflation will provide crucial insights. The Federal Reserve’s interest rate decisions remain a key focus for market participants. Companies like AppLovin and Datadog will release their earnings reports.

The Dow Jones Industrial Average crossed the 50,000 mark. Chipmakers like Nvidia surged as tech giants Amazon and Alphabet announced significant investments in AI infrastructure. This spending is expected to boost AI data center development. Software companies also saw gains, recovering from recent dips. The market showed a shift with investors diversifying away from tech.

The Dow surged above 50,000 points for the first time Friday, shrugging off worries connected to artificial intelligence companies while traders focused on the prospects for US growth and Federal Reserve interest rate cuts. Earlier milestones for the Dow include when it hit 40,000 points in May 2024 and 30,000 points in November 2020.
